Statutes Limitations

Asbestos victims need to know the statutes of limitation for their case. Finding the right lawyer early in the process will ensure that your claim is filed by the timeframe established by your state. This will allow your attorney to conduct an investigation into the party responsible and gather all evidence needed to prove the case.

Typically the statute of limitation for personal injury claims begins when the incident occurred. However, in asbestos cases involving mesothelioma and other lung diseases resulting from exposure to the toxic mineral, patients may not know they have a disease until decades after the initial exposure. States have adopted special rules to extend the statutes of limitations in these cases because of the long latency periods for asbestos-related diseases.

In New York, for example plaintiffs Can I Claim Compensation For Asbestos Exposure file a lawsuit three years after the date of diagnosis. In Minnesota, asbestos victims also have two years to file lawsuits against mesothelioma or other ailments.

Additionally, some cases have been filed after the time limit has expired. This is because many victims experienced the debilitating symptoms of mesothelioma before they were diagnosed. It can be difficult for them to keep on top of the time-limits and know what it means for their particular situation.

Damages

In asbestos lawsuits, victims receive financial compensation for the injuries they've suffered. This could come from companies that produced or installed asbestos or trust funds set up to pay mesothelioma-related claims. The amount of money that is paid depends on the victim's exposure, their symptoms, and the type of cancer they've been diagnosed with.

Every case of exposure to asbestos resulting in illness is unique. However, there are some elements that are common to all cases. For instance, a mesothelioma lawyer must prove that the victim was exposed to asbestos and that the exposure caused a serious health issue like mesothelioma, or another asbestos-related disease. In addition, the plaintiff must also prove that the company that was responsible for their injuries.

To prove this, a mesothelioma law firm must collect and review medical documentation of the person's exposure. This can include employment records or police reports as well as medical tests. Additionally, the mesothelioma attorney must be able to show that the asbestos cancer lawsuit lawyer mesothelioma settlement company exhibited negligence by failing to provide the required warnings to employees and customers about the dangers of the product.

In some instances, victims can also receive punitive damages. This is meant to punish the company and discourage them from acting negligently in the future. These damages are usually given in addition to compensatory damages.

Compensation in a lawsuit involving asbestos may be used to cover the cost of the primary treatment, the loss of income, as well as the suffering and pain that comes with the illness. This compensation may also help ensure that the responsible companies manage asbestos correctly in the future, and prevent further harm to others.

asbestos settlement victims usually receive compensation for their losses via an arbitration or settlement process. They can be negotiated prior to, during or following the trial. A trial is when a judge or jury decides the amount of money an organization has to pay the victim. The victim can accept, counter or reject this decision. During a trial the victim may also decide to appeal. This could delay any monetary award, but it will require defendants post an initial bond until the appeal is resolved.

Preparing for Trial

The mesothelioma trial process will begin when your lawyer has collected all the relevant information to support your case. This includes your medical proof of mesothelioma and a list asbestos companies or defendants you believe are responsible for your exposure.

During the discovery phase, your attorney will demand that the defendants submit any documents supporting your claim that asbestos was exposed to you. They will also demand that you take a deposition, which is an opportunity for lawyers from both sides to ask you questions under the oath. Your lawyer will prepare your deposition and will be by you every step of the process. Your mesothelioma lawyer will prepare a video recording or audio recording of you testifying if you are unable travel due to the condition. This will be used in court.

After all evidence has been obtained, your attorney will file the lawsuit in a court in the area where you live. The judge will then set an appointment for an settlement conference or trial. This could take a few weeks or even one year after filing the lawsuit.
